Output 24a2072313d623125b992febd55b09abb624de42811c3d6d5fd3549d610fdd7a:1

value
571698
script pubkey
OP_0 OP_PUSHBYTES_20 308acff0bd995ad70ad3e163efabdb73a62f1403
address
bc1qxz9vlu9an9ddwzknu937l27mwwnz79qraqhvw5
transaction
24a2072313d623125b992febd55b09abb624de42811c3d6d5fd3549d610fdd7a
spent
true